Output 0659dfa3f87eebd7b80ee98d75ab0eff84dbc7f2ec35e104dce2a912058abfbd:1

value
4503415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37b6b51a2415610dde5268d35ec3a6a7b102ed4d OP_EQUALVERIFY OP_CHECKSIG
address
165b3HZL31eyTAaTdPrmgm7svfDMfjVM93
transaction
0659dfa3f87eebd7b80ee98d75ab0eff84dbc7f2ec35e104dce2a912058abfbd
spent
true